
Eikowa Contemporary is currently showcasing its latest exhibition, “Beyond the Surface: A Journey Through Form and Abstraction”, which began on September 13 and will run until September 30.
This exhibition offers a profound exploration of contemporary art, where corporeal and abstract elements intersect, challenging viewers to look beyond initial impressions.
The exhibition features a diverse array of artistic approaches that push the boundaries of various media. Each piece invites a deeper engagement, encouraging visitors to explore the intricate layers of meaning and emotion embedded within the art.
By reconsidering the relationship between surface and substance, “Beyond the Surface” aims to offer a more nuanced interaction with the narratives conveyed through abstraction and materiality.

The lineup of artists includes Vinod Daroz, renowned for his ceramic works exploring themes of sacred union; Somu Desai, whose metallic pieces reflect on societal facades; Himanshu Joshi, presenting intricate fractal digital prints; Tapas Biswas, known for mixed media sculptures that reimagine urban consciousness; Gaurishankar Soni, offering compelling mixed-media compositions; and Bhuwal Prasad, showcasing tribal-inspired abstractions.
When: 6 PM onwards; Until September 30
Where: Eikowa Gallery, Block A, A29/5A, Sector 28, DLF Phase 1, Gurugram
